The Devastating Effects of Cocaine Addiction

Understanding the Risks: A Closer Look at Cocaine's Impact on Mental and Physical Health

Cocaine is a highly addictive drug that can have severe and long-lasting effects on an individual's mental and physical health. It is often used as a recreational drug, but its use can quickly spiral out of control, leading to addiction and devastating consequences.

The risks associated with cocaine use are numerous and varied. In addition to the obvious physical health risks, such as cardiovascular problems and respiratory issues, cocaine use has also been linked to increased rates of depression, anxiety, and psychosis.

The Impact on Relationships: How Cocaine Addiction Affects Family and Friends

Cocaine addiction not only affects the individual using the drug, but also has far-reaching consequences for their loved ones. The financial burden of supporting an addict can be crushing, and the emotional toll of watching a family member or friend spiral out of control is immeasurable.

The relationships that were once strong and healthy begin to fray as the addict becomes increasingly isolated and withdrawn. Trust is broken, and the sense of security and stability is shattered.

Seeking Help: A Guide to Recovery and Rehabilitation

Recovery from cocaine addiction is possible, but it requires a comprehensive treatment plan that addresses the physical, emotional, and psychological aspects of addiction.

There are many resources available to help individuals overcome their addiction. From inpatient rehabilitation centers to outpatient therapy programs, there are options for every stage of recovery.
